This British 1907 pattern bayonet was made by the Remington Arms Company in America in July, 1915. The first delivery from Remington to the UK was in July 1915.

Remington only produced 100,000 1907 pattern bayonets in total. Now-a-days, Remington made P1907 bayonets quite rare.

The 424mm, single edged blade has a long narrow fuller and rounded spine. The blade retains its original factory edge and is in very good condition.

The ricasso is marked with the pattern designation, 1907 and the date of manufacture 7 ’15 (July 1915) below which is stamped the circular Remington maker’s mark.

The obverse ricasso bears the War Department broad arrow and bend test stamp, an Enfield inspection stamps and a British, American based inspector’s stamp.

The cross guard, muzzle ring and pommel are in great condition and retain their blued finish. The press stud and catch mechanism are crisp and in perfect working order. The wooden grip scales are in very good condition and are held firmly in place by the two original screws.

The bayonet is complete with its Remington made brown leather scabbard with a teardrop stud. The scabbard is in very good condition. The leather and stitching are sound and the locket and chape retain their blued finish. The bayonet sheathes and draws smoothly and is held firmly within the scabbard.

This is an excellent early example of a rare Remington made British P1907 bayonet.
